What US ITAR - International Traffic in Arms Regulations (22 CFR Parts 120-130) Defense Articles Export Controls requires

The International Traffic in Arms Regulations (ITAR) at 22 CFR Parts 120-130, implemented under the Arms Export Control Act (AECA), regulate the export and import of defense articles, defense services, and related technical data listed on the US Munitions List (USML). Any person or organisation that exports ITAR-controlled items must register with the Directorate of Defense Trade Controls (DDTC) and obtain a licence or use an applicable exemption. Violations carry criminal penalties up to $1 million per violation and civil fines up to $1.3 million per violation.
